The Ritual

Ritual: (noun), A ceremony with an established order of repeated words, phrases, or series of actions in front of an audience.

The rituals of our lives provide us time and space to honor the things that matter most to us.  During a wedding, friends and family gather to celebrate the couple.  Perhaps this is the only time both sides of this extended family will be in the same place at the same time.  They gather because it’s an important part of honoring the people and relationships on their journey together.  We participate in the ritual, share a meal together, and dance!  Every part of the ritual is a chance to strengthen relationships and show our love and support.

If your headshots feel a little “off”… it’s usually not your camera—it’s your lighting.

Here are 5 mistakes I see all the time:

1️⃣ Lighting from below 
  Creates unflattering shadows. Keep your light slightly above eye level.
 
2️⃣ Too much (or too harsh) light 
  Softer, controlled light will always look more professional.
 
3️⃣ No direction to your light 
  Flat lighting = flat images. You need some angle to create depth.
 
4️⃣ Mixing multiple light sources 
  This is how you end up with weird color and inconsistent tones.
 
5️⃣ Ignoring catchlights 
  Small detail, big impact—this is what brings life to your subject’s eyes.
 
Lighting doesn’t need to be complicated… it just needs to be intentional.
